An MLO receives a 'Caution' message from an automated underwriting system along with an approval recommendation. What does this indicate?

Correct Answer

B) There are risk factors present that require careful attention and possibly additional documentation

A 'Caution' message indicates that while the loan may be approvable, there are specific risk factors that require careful attention, additional documentation, or enhanced review to ensure the loan meets guidelines.
